Recent Weather Related Causes of Power Outages in Clinton County

Thunderstorm Wind. Large tree downed on an unoccupied car by thunderstorm wind gusts. Numerous powerlines also downed.

June 29, 2023

Thunderstorm Wind. Thunderstorm winds downed trees and power lines across multiple areas between Frankfort and Michigantown.

May 25, 2022

Thunderstorm Wind. Power poles and three inch tree limbs broken by thunderstorm wind gusts.

December 11, 2021

Thunderstorm Wind. Tree limbs, trees, and power lines downed due to thunderstorm wind gusts in the nearby area.

July 11, 2020

Thunderstorm Wind. Tree limbs, trees, and power lines downed due to thunderstorm wind gusts in the nearby area. A roof was blown off a house near the intersection of State Road 39 and County Road 700N.

July 11, 2020
